Engineering Technician III - Kwajalein Atoll - 3693
RGNext is a company that provides operation and sustainment of mission-critical systems for space launch and defense. They are seeking an Engineering Technician III to assist engineering staff with operations, maintenance, calibration, and troubleshooting of radar systems, while ensuring the smooth functioning of day-to-day radar operations.

Responsibilities
Assist engineering staff with operations, maintenance, calibration, troubleshooting, repair and modification of C-band and Ka-band radar systems
Assist with equipment design modifications, including fabrication, drawings and testing
Preform daily calibrations as required
Perform necessary diagnostics and repair of radar equipment
Maintain maintenance schedules, spare parts, and equipment inventory
Support day-to-day operations with the Radar Operations Director to meet 24x7 radar mission requirements
Perform occasional shift work to support operational tasking
Perform other related duties as assigned
Qualification
Required
Able to maintain & update schematics and manuals
Excellent working understanding of engineering practices including but not limited to: Soldering, Circuit board repairs, Willing to learn System and component level troubleshooting using oscilloscopes, spectrum analyzers, power meters, and other RF test equipment
General understanding of RF and Microwave receivers and transmitters
Willingness and physical ability to carry equipment weighing 50 lbs
Associate's degree in electronics or a two-year technical school, or equivalent military experience or equivalent combination of education and experience
Five (5) or more years of electronics related experience
Must be able to obtain and maintain a DoD Secret security clearance which requires U.S. Citizenship
Must be able to relocate to the United States Army Kwajalein Atoll, Marshall Islands
Must be able to obtain and maintain a U.S. passport
Climber II Certification or ability to obtain certification within 6 months of hire (local training and testing provided)
The flexibility to work occasional non-duty hours or on weekends to support specific project or mission requirements
This position is unaccompanied
Willingness and physical ability to work at moderate heights, up to 100 ft
Preferred
Familiarity and experience with Allen Bradley control systems and radar antenna servo control systems
High Power Radar knowledge and experience in some or all of the following: transmitters, receivers, digital systems or operations
